Justin Thomas Helps Hurricane Matthew Survivors

Reported by Convoy of Hope

After three impressive weeks in the PGA Tour, Justin Thomas’ #MakingBirdiesforMatthew has come to an end. Convoy of Hope thanks Justin, his sponsors, and his fans for generating more than $35,000 in donations for Convoy’s Hurricane Matthew disaster response.

Thomas, who pledged to donate $250 for every birdie, made 70 birdies over three recent PGA Tour events and went on to win the CIMB Classic event in Malaysia!

Because of generous friends like Justin, we have distributed 851,982 pounds of food, hygiene kits, cleaning supplies, and water in Florida, Georgia, North Carolina, and South Carolina. Internationally, more than 2.3 million meals and 88,000 water units were given to people affected by the hurricane.

Convoy of Hope congratulates Justin on his success and thanks everyone who participated in #MakingBirdiesForMatthew. Convoy can’t wait to partner with Justin and other athletes in the future to continue spreading hope around the world.
